Gabriel Garcia Marquez was a Colombian novelist and Nobel Prize winner known for his influential works of magical realism, including "One Hundred Years of Solitude." He is widely regarded as one of the greatest writers of the 20th century and his works have had a significant impact on literature worldwide. Additionally, he was a key figure in the Latin American literary movement known as the "Boom."

Shakespeare's first published work was Venus and Adonis in 1593. His other long poem The Rape of Lucrece was published the next year. About half of the plays were published individually over the years. In 1609 the Sonnets were published. In 1623 the First Folio, the first collection of Shakespeare's plays, was first published. Many of his plays were published for the first time at that time.
